A Winnipeg father is desperate to get his 21-year-old son, who is diagnosed with schizophrenia, out of jail and into a proper mental health facility. Donovan Mohammed was charged with assault after attacking his father and was deemed not criminally responsible. As Talia Ricci reports, there aren’t enough beds for mental health patients in Manitoba.
